Core Dietitian - Assessment Treatment & Rehabilitation

Health New Zealand - Te Whatu Ora
Auckland, Auckland
Part time
2 days ago
Part time 0.7fte, permanent

Remuneration as per PSA Allied Health MECA guidelines (between step 3 - 10)

Health New Zealand | Te Whatu Ora is firmly grounded in the principles of Te Tiriti o Waitangi and is committed to building a health system that serves all New Zealanders.

The Opportunity:

We have an exciting opportunity for a dietitian to join our close-knit and innovative team within the Assessment, Treatment, and Rehabilitation Service at Middlemore Hospital.

The ideal applicant is self-motivated and enjoys working in a flexible and challenging environment. You will have great communication skills, be able to think outside the box, manage your time efficiently, and enjoy working both independently and as part of a strong, quality-focused team. You will also be involved in training dietetic students and encouraged to participate in service development and project work.

The employment package includes a refund of your annual practicing certificate, support towards the cost of your Dietitians New Zealand subscription, and a personal study allowance. We provide and support regular professional development opportunities, practice reviews, performance development planning, and regular professional supervision.

Essential:

  • BCapSc or BSc, and Post Grad Dip Diet or MSc Dietetics (or equivalent as recognised by the NZ Dietitians Board).
  • NZRD with current annual practicing certificate endorsed with prescribing rights
  • Clinical experience and knowledge of dietetic practice
  • Excellent time management and communication skills
  • Cultural awareness and understanding
  • Self-motivated and enthusiastic
